If /MAIL folders on the laptop (including the filters) are not > identical, then you end up with duplicate messages, and > synchronisation does not work on filters or account settings (in my > experience anyway). Ok, good to kwow :-) > My way of dealing with this is to use synchronisation most of the time, > but every month or two, delete all of the laptop /mail folders and > replace them with a backup from the PC. This means that synchronisation > will work well again until I change filters on the PC, or clear out > old messages. I don't do it very often, because I use different > account settings on my laptop (leave messages on server, use X-Ray), > and it takes time to change these for 7 accounts.
